Countdown to Georgia football (historical edition): No. 94 – the late Quentin Moses

With 94 days left, today we honor another DGD, defensive end Quentin Moses. Moses was born on November 18th, 1983 in Athens, Georgia. The 6’5, 260 pound lineman attended Cedar Shoals High School, where he was named to the AJC Top 50 in Georgia.

He attended UGA from 2005-06, where he tallied 77 total tackles, 16 sacks, 32.5 tackles for loss, and one forced fumble. He was drafted at the 65th overall pick in 2007 by the Oakland Raiders.

Moses played a few seasons in the NFL for the Raiders, Cardinals, and Dolphins before losing an NFL job. Unfortunately, Moses lost his life to a house fire on February 12th, 2017. May he rest in peace.
